Water Cock
  1. A large gallinule (Gallicrex cristatus) native of Australia, India, and the East Indies. In the breeding season the male is black and has a fleshy red caruncle, or horn, on the top of its head. Called also kora.
Water Color
  1. A color ground with water and gum or other glutinous medium; a color the vehicle of which is water; -- so called in distinction from oil color.
Water-Colorist
  1. One who paints in water colors.
Water Course
  1. A stream of water; a river or brook.
Water Craft
  1. Any vessel or boat plying on water; vessels and boats, collectively.
Water Crake
  1. The dipper. (b) The spotted crake (Porzana maruetta). See Illust. of Crake. (c) The swamp hen, or crake, of Australia.
Water Crane
  1. A goose-neck apparatus for supplying water from an elevated tank, as to the tender of a locomotive.
Water Cress
  1. A perennial cruciferous herb (Nasturtium officinale) growing usually in clear running or spring water. The leaves are pungent, and used for salad and as an antiscorbutic.
Water Crow
  1. The dipper. (b) The European coot.
Water Cure
  1. Hydropathy.
